Output 9ec21696854a78a24ff1c1f006fde59069f9e5258dabdd1f55263cf70e672690:1

value
1475070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84a84bbb26489001c917b985c1957a998b0ddd9 OP_EQUAL
address
3MQf9cbULQWpuFQ374rGTcRwkhVv6AJnqs
transaction
9ec21696854a78a24ff1c1f006fde59069f9e5258dabdd1f55263cf70e672690
spent
true